Hello,

I have been using a vanity generator (Silver Thread Software LLC) for the past week in order to get my name in my btc address. It is brutal+ process to find the private key and may take months or even years to crack it with a cpu. But here is the thought: with unlimited power and time it is possible to generate a private key that corresponds to an existing 34 character public key? I believe this is far from happening at the present day due to the computational power required for the task but recent development in quantum computers and machine learning may be a step. 

Anyways, for all other newbies this a great way to give your bitcoin address a little more customization and if any more experienced users find this interesting please leave your feedback and thoughts (statistical data and estimates would be appreciated).
